Core Insights - The "Four Major Chronic Diseases" National Science and Technology Major Project has been launched in Jiangsu Taizhou, focusing on cancer, cardiovascular, respiratory, and metabolic disease prevention and control [1] Group 1: Project Overview - The project, approved in May 2023, is the only regional plan selected in the Yangtze River Delta and has a four-year implementation period [1] - The project aims to address key challenges in the prevention and control of chronic diseases by leveraging existing research capabilities [1] Group 2: Innovative Approaches - The project is based on the previous "Star Network Plan," which promotes an integrated chronic disease prevention and control model [1] - The core concept of the "Star Network Plan" is to empower grassroots healthcare through "Artificial Intelligence + Healthcare," shifting the focus from disease treatment to health promotion [1] Group 3: Healthcare Network Structure - The project aims to establish a four-tier chronic disease management network consisting of regional medical centers, county hospitals, central hospitals, and grassroots clinics [1] - It utilizes technologies such as the Internet of Things, artificial intelligence, and mobile wearable devices to enhance grassroots healthcare institutions [1] Group 4: Comprehensive Service Model - The initiative provides a full-process individualized prevention and treatment service, including prevention, screening, rescue, treatment, and rehabilitation [1] - The goal is to encourage chronic disease patients to return to community health services and to reintegrate rural doctors into the primary prevention and control efforts [1]
